Why is My Power Window Not Working and How to Fix It
Common Causes of Power Window Failures
Before diving into repair methods, it’s essential to identify the potential reasons why your power window might not be working. Some of the most frequent causes include:
- Blown Fuse: The fuse that controls the power window circuit may have blown due to a surge or electrical fault.
- Faulty Power Window Switch: The switch itself can wear out over time or become damaged, preventing proper operation.
- Broken Window Regulator or Motor: The motor that powers the window or the mechanical regulator mechanism can fail, especially after years of use.
- Wiring Issues: Damaged, frayed, or disconnected wires can interrupt power flow to the window motor.
- Obstructions or Mechanical Jams: Debris or misaligned components can prevent the window from moving freely.
Step-by-Step Troubleshooting Guide
If your power window isn’t functioning, follow these steps to diagnose and potentially fix the problem:
1. Check the Vehicle’s Fuse
The first step is to verify whether the fuse controlling the power windows is blown. Locate the fuse box in your vehicle, which is often found under the dashboard or in the engine compartment. Consult your owner’s manual for the exact fuse location and rating.
- Remove the fuse using a fuse puller or needle-nose pliers.
- Inspect the fuse for a broken wire or burn marks.
- If the fuse is blown, replace it with one of the same amperage rating.
After replacing the fuse, test the window again. If it works, the issue was likely a blown fuse. If not, proceed to the next step.
2. Test the Power Window Switch
The switch may be faulty or worn out, especially if the window works intermittently or only from certain positions.
- Try operating the window from both the driver’s switch and the individual door switch (if applicable).
- If the window responds from the driver’s switch but not from the door switch, the door switch may be defective.
- To test the switch, remove the switch panel (usually held by screws or clips) and use a multimeter to check for continuity when pressing the button.
If the switch is faulty, replacing it is generally straightforward and affordable. Consult your vehicle’s repair manual for specific instructions.
3. Inspect the Window Motor and Regulator
If the fuse and switch are functioning properly, the next step is to examine the motor and regulator mechanism.
- Remove the door panel to access the window components (refer to your vehicle’s repair manual).
- Manually move the window to see if it’s stuck or jammed. If it moves freely, the motor may be at fault.
- Test the motor by applying direct power from the battery (carefully!), or use a multimeter to check if power reaches the motor when the switch is pressed.
If the motor is dead, you'll need to replace it. This usually involves disconnecting the wiring, removing mounting bolts, and installing a new motor. Also, inspect the regulator for damage or wear and replace if necessary.
4. Examine Wiring and Connectors
Damaged or loose wiring can interrupt power to the window motor. Look for:
- Corroded or broken wires
- Loose connectors or disconnected wires
- Signs of water damage or corrosion inside the door panel
If you find damaged wiring, repair or replace the affected sections. Ensuring all electrical connections are secure can restore proper window operation.
5. Check for Mechanical Obstructions
Sometimes, debris or misaligned components can prevent the window from moving. To check:
- Inspect the window tracks for dirt, debris, or obstructions.
- Ensure the window glass is properly aligned within the tracks.
- Lubricate the tracks with silicone spray to facilitate smooth movement.
If mechanical parts are damaged or bent, they may need to be replaced or realigned to restore functionality.
Additional Tips for Troubleshooting
- Always disconnect the vehicle’s battery before working on electrical components to prevent shocks or shorts.
- Use a multimeter to check for voltage at various points if you’re comfortable with electrical diagnostics.
- Keep in mind that some issues may require professional repair, especially if the problem involves complex wiring or internal motor failure.

Preventative Maintenance Tips
- Regularly clean window tracks and lubricate moving parts to prevent jams and wear.
- Address electrical issues promptly to avoid further damage or costly repairs.
- Keep the door interior dry and free of debris to protect electrical components.
